Eastman Chemical CO Tennessee Operations

Total reported releases 3.6M lb rose modestly year over year (+7%). Total releases concentrations have fallen 30% since 2010.

100 EASTMAN RD, Kingsport, Tennessee · 325211 · Chemicals · operated by Eastman Chemical Co

Source. EPA Toxics Release Inventory · retrieved 2026-05-07. Reporting year 2024. TRI is a federal public-domain dataset under 17 USC §105.

What this is not. TRI quantifies releases reported by the facility under EPCRA §313 — not ambient air or water concentrations measured at receptors. We do not attribute individual health outcomes to specific facilities; that exceeds what the data can support.
